A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|
Back to Blog
Ejabberd active directory authentication1/22/2024 ![]() ![]() Support for web clients: HTTP Polling 9 and HTTP Binding (BOSH) 10 services. Publish-Subscribe 7 component with support for Personal Eventing via Pubsub 8. Multi-User Chat 6 module with support for clustering and HTML logging. IPv6 support both for c2s and s2s connections. Statistics via Statistics Gathering (XEP ). Compressing XML streams with Stream Compression (XEP ). Authentication Others Internal Authentication. Databases Internal database for fast deployment (Mnesia). Web Admin accessible via HTTPS secure access. Security SASL and STARTTLS for c2s and s2s connections. Extend ejabberd with your own custom modules. Many protocols supportedĩ 1.2 Additional Features Additional Features Moreover, ejabberd comes with a wide range of other state-of-the-art features: Modular Load only the modules you want. Open Standards: ejabberd is the first Open Source Jabber server claiming to fully comply to the XMPP standard. Related features are: Translated to 24 languages. Hence it is very well suited in a globalized world. Internationalized: ejabberd leads in internationalization. Can integrate with existing authentication mechanisms. Straightforward installers for Linux, Mac OS X, and Windows. Other administrator benefits include: Comprehensive documentation. As a result you do not need to install an external database, an external web server, amongst others because everything is already included, and ready to run out of the box. Administrator Friendly: ejabberd is built on top of the Open Source Erlang. In addition, nodes also can be added or replaced on the fly. This means that if one of the nodes crashes, the others will continue working without disruption. Fault-tolerant: You can deploy an ejabberd cluster so that all the information required for a properly working service will be replicated permanently on all nodes. Accordingly, you do not need to buy an expensive high-end machine to support tens of thousands concurrent users. When you need more capacity you can simply add a new cheap node to your cluster. ![]() Distributed: You can run ejabberd on a cluster of machines and all of them will serve the same Jabber domain(s). Introduction 1.1 Key Features ejabberd is: Cross-platform: ejabberd runs under Microsoft Windows and Unix derived systems such as Linux, FreeBSD and NetBSD. ejabberd is suitable for small deployments, whether they need to be scalable or not, as well as extremely big deploymentsĨ 8 1. ejabberd is designed to be a rock-solid and feature rich XMPP server. ejabberd is cross-platform, distributed, fault-tolerant, and based on open standards to achieve real-time communication. 1 ejabberd Installation and Operation Guide ejabberd Development Teamģ Contents 1 Introduction Key Features Additional Features Installing ejabberd Installing ejabberd with Binary Installer Installing ejabberd with Operating System Specific Packages Installing ejabberd with CEAN Installing ejabberd from Source Code Requirements Download Source Code Compile Install Start Specific Notes for BSD Specific Notes for Sun Solaris Specific Notes for Microsoft Windows Create a Jabber Account for Administration Upgrading ejabberdĤ 4 Contents 3 Configuring ejabberd Basic Configuration Host Names Virtual Hosting Listening Ports Authentication Access Rules Shapers Default Language Database and LDAP Configuration MySQL Microsoft SQL Server PostgreSQL ODBC Compatible LDAP Modules Configuration Modules Overview Common Options mod announce mod disco mod echo mod http bind mod http fileserver mod irc mod last mod muc mod muc log mod offlineĥ CONTENTS mod privacy mod private mod proxy mod pubsub mod register mod roster mod service log mod shared roster mod stats mod time mod vcard mod vcard ldap mod version Managing an ejabberd Server ejabberdctl Commands Erlang Runtime System Web Admin Ad-hoc Commands Change Computer Hostname Securing ejabberd Firewall Settings epmd Erlang Cookie Erlang Node Name Securing Sensible FilesĦ 6 Contents 6 Clustering How it Works Router Local Router Session Manager s2s Manager Clustering Setup Service Load-Balancing Components Load-Balancing Domain Load-Balancing Algorithm Load-Balancing Buckets Debugging Log Files Debug Console Watchdog Alerts A Internationalization and Localization 93 B Release Notes 95 C Acknowledgements 97 D Copyright Information 99ħ Chapter 1 Introduction ejabberd is a free and open source instant messaging server written in Erlang 1. ![]()
0 Comments
Read More
Leave a Reply. |